Barry Mannilow Just Won't Die

Barry Mannilow just won’t die,

His songs assault us wherever we go.

On elevators they wait until the doors close,

When Somewhere in the Night bores deep into our heads

And staying for days

 

This Ones for You, just why is it needed?

With no redeeming qualities

That I can see,

It’s not easy to dance to

And just what does it mean?

 

Thank you Entertainment tonight,

For keeping Barry right on the front

With chipper stories as your hook

Drawing us under your spell.

 

Mandy, Copacabana, or I go Crazy

To name a few

Can only mean that Barry was sent to earth

By Satan himself.

 

How do we rid ourselves

Of Barry’s curse?

By living in the wilderness

Or a bullet in the brain.
